﻿body
{
    margin: 0;
    padding: 0;
}

body, table
{
    font-family: sans-serif;
    font-size: 0.7em;
}

form
{
    margin: 0px;
    padding: 0px;
}
a
{
    color: #C21100;
}
a:hover
{
    color: #A60002;
}

img
{
    border: 0px;
    margin: 0.2em 0.8em 0.2em 0.8em;
}

.left
{
    text-align: left;
}

.right
{
    text-align: right;
}

.center
{
    text-align: center;
}

.small
{
    font-size: smaller;
}

.reset
{
    display: block;
    font-size: 0px;
    line-height: 0px;
    height: 0.1px;
    overflow: hidden;
    clear: both;
}

.invisible
{
    display: none;
}

.floatLeft
{
    float: left;
}

.floatRight
{
    float: right;
}
.margintop
{
    margin-top: 5px;
}
.decnone
{
    text-decoration: none;
}
.main
{
    position: relative;
    margin: 0 auto;
    width: 980px;
    background: url(../imgX/bck_main0.gif) repeat-y center top;
    min-height: 600px;
}
div#header
{
    background: url(../imgX/SOUS_IndexHeader.jpg) no-repeat center top;
    height: 346px;
}
div#main0
{
}
div#main1 .Article, div#main2 .Article, div#main3 .Article
{
    padding-left: 32px;
    padding-right: 32px;
}
div#main1 p, div#main2 p, div#main3 p
{
    margin-top: 3px;
    margin-bottom: 3px;
    margin-left: 0px;
    margin-right: 0px;
}
div#main1 div.Sep, div#main2 div.Sep, div#main3 div.Sep
{
    margin-bottom: 8px;
    margin-top: 8px;
    padding-bottom: 0px;
    margin-left: 32px;
    margin-right: 32px;
    clear: both;
    border-bottom: dotted 1px #C1C1C1;
}
div#main1 .SepFirst, div#main3 .SepFirst
{
    margin-top: 6px;
}
div#main2 .SepFirst
{
    margin-top: 120px;
}
div#main2 .Centrum
{
    position: absolute;
    display: block;
    margin-top: 120px;
    left: 350px;
    top: 272px;
    width: 60px;
    height: 30px;
}
div#main1
{
    width: 340px;
    float: left;
}
div#main3
{
    width: 340px;
    float: left;
}
div#main2
{
    width: 300px;
    float: left;
    background: url(../imgX/bck_main0.jpg) no-repeat right top;
}
div.MainFoot
{
    clear: both;
    border-top: solid 4px #000;
    height: 40px;
    background-color: #919297;
}

div#languages
{
    position: absolute;
    right: 0px;
    top: 10px;
    z-index: 3;
    font-size: 11px;
    padding: 2px;
}

a.hSk
{
    position: absolute;
    display: block;
    width: 335px;
    height: 250px;
    top: 42px;
    left: 0px;
    cursor: pointer;
    z-index: 24;
    /*border: solid 1px green;*/
}

a.hCe
{
    position: absolute;
    display: block;
    width: 300px;
    height: 230px;
    top: 235px;
    left: 339px;
    z-index: 4;
    cursor: pointer;
    /*border: solid 1px green;*/
}

a.hUc
{
    position: absolute;
    display: block;
    width: 337px;
    height: 250px;
    top: 42px;
    right: 0px;
    z-index: 4;
    cursor: pointer;
    /*border: solid 1px green;*/
}
